Define success in ordinary numbers prior to you define deliverables

Most contracts avoid straight to activities: audits, keyword study, technological solutions, material calendars. Those matter, yet you do not buy tasks. You purchase end results. Press the company to compose success standards in numbers the CFO respects. If they can not, you are paying for busywork.

For a Boston e‑commerce brand name, success may check out as a 15 to 25 percent quarter‑over‑quarter rise in natural revenue for non‑branded terms. For a neighborhood service firm collaborating with a Neighborhood Search Engine Optimization Consultant, it could be a 30 percent lift in qualified telephone calls from Google Business Profile within six months. For a B2B SaaS business near Kendall Square, it might be a 20 percent rise in activations stemming from organic web traffic with a last non‑direct click model. The specific numbers can be a range, however the metric meanings can not be vague.

Spell out exactly how you will certainly connect outcomes. If the company utilizes assisted conversions by default and your group lives by last‑click revenue in Shopify, you will fight over numbers by month two. Select the design in composing. Include resource of fact systems too: Google Analytics 4, Search Console, call tracking, CRM, and any kind of BI layer. Make a decision in advance that establishes tracking, possesses UTM discipline, and pays for any third‑party devices used to gauge outcomes.

If the agency pushes back with the line that "search engine optimization can not guarantee results," that is reasonable. No one can ensure ranking. They can commit to a measurement framework, website traffic top quality targets, and directional milestones. If the company will not place any risk in the ground, think about that its own data point.

Scope that closes technicalities instead of developing them

Scope rising cost of living kills SEO projects slowly. A well‑written extent clarifies what is included, what is excluded, and what activates a change order. Words matter.

Include a material throughput flooring. If material becomes part of the plan, specify the variety of pieces per month, word count arrays, whether the web content requires subject‑matter interviews, and just how production stops briefly are handled. If your internal team is accountable for testimonials in a controlled market like health care or money, jot down the anticipated turn-around time and what happens if evaluations take much longer. Without this, you will spend for still capacity.

Define technological SEO ownership. Boston companies usually work on complex stacks, from headless Shopify to Drupal builds at universities. If your dev team possesses execution, the company's range should include detailed tickets with approval requirements and test strategies. If the agency carries out, clear up gain access to degrees, organizing protocols, rollback procedures, and who pays for any kind of engineering support hours.

Local search engine optimization terms call for added accuracy. If you are hiring for local ranking gains, list the specific locations and service locations. Specify NAP standardization regulations, citation networks to target, and the plan for Google Service Account blog posts, Q&A, and evaluation administration. If the agency claims to produce or "claim" listings, guarantee you keep ownership of all listings and that they are created under your accounts, not theirs.

Clarify out‑of‑scope products to avoid shocks. Common gotchas include web design refreshes, conversion rate optimization tasks, ecommerce feed work, schema for product variations, and translation for multilingual sites that serve Boston's diverse areas. These might be required later on, but compose them as different paths with ball park pricing, not obscure "assistance as required."

Fee structure that aligns incentives with your risk tolerance

You can structure SEO costs in a couple of convenient means. Flat retainers stay typical. Efficiency or hybrid models can function if dimension is clean. The key is to line up motivations and cap downside.

Retainers with clear throughput and a quarterly reset are one of the most predictable. They generally consist of a fixed number of hours or, better, dealt with deliverable ability, such as audits, a set content quantity, link acquisition speed, and month-to-month technical sprints. Avoid open‑ended hours that vanish into condition calls.

Hybrid models tie a portion of fees to results. As an example, a base retainer covers core job, with a quarterly bonus offer tied to non‑branded natural income growth or to incremental leads verified in your CRM. If you go this course, secure down the metric, baseline duration, and data source. Specify limits that cause bonuses and ceilings that safeguard your margin.

Pure pay‑for‑performance designs seldom survive call with real data. They can drive short‑term strategies that harm long‑term authority. If a firm urges, constrain the design to certain, manageable goals like web content production and posting cadence while you maintain outcome measurement in a different assessment framework.

For local organizations, bundles from a Regional SEO Specialist usually pack Google Organization Profile optimization, citation clean-up, and a testimonial strategy. If your company has several areas across Boston and Cambridge, work out a per‑location discount and a phased rollout that prioritizes your highest‑margin communities. Call for that any type of directory charges be passed through at expense with receipts.

Ask for a 60 to 90‑day analysis choice prior to committing to a complete year. A paid analysis with a substantial result, such as a technological audit, keyword map, and material strategy, offers both celebrations a chance to check fit. If you proceed, credit scores part of the analysis charge towards the continuous engagement.

Term size, revival reasoning, and your exit ramp

SEO takes some time, but long contracts without safeguards end up being manacles. In Boston's fast‑moving industries, pivots happen when an item launches very early or when the sales team adjustments technique. Create versatility into your term.

A 6‑month first term with a 30‑day evaluation checkpoint at month 3 strikes an excellent equilibrium. If leading indications are off, you can readjust strategies early. Automatic month‑to‑month renewal after the first term helps both sides stay clear of paperwork fatigue, yet it needs to permit a 30‑day discontinuation without penalty.

Build an organized wind‑down clause. If you work out termination, the company must deliver all in‑progress job, transfer accounts, and offer a recap of open possibilities. Link last repayment to conclusion of the wind‑down deliverables instead of the calendar day. This protects against both the awkward scramble and the ghosting that in some cases occurs after a cancellation email.

If the agency supplies a discount rate for a 12‑month commitment, request for a cog. For instance, you devote to 12 months at a decreased rate with the ability to leave at month six if the agreed leading indications underperform by a set margin. This maintains pressure on both sides to act upon signals, not hope.

Ownership, gain access to, and the tricks to your data

Never outsource the keys to your home. Agreements need to mention that you have all accounts, buildings, web content, creative, and information. That appears apparent up until you try to reclaim a Google Analytics building developed under a firm email.

Require that all residential or commercial properties be developed within your company's accounts: Browse Console, GA4, Tag Supervisor, Google Business Account, material administration systems, call tracking, and any kind of third‑party search engine optimization solutions. The agency should verify via customer roles. For devices like Ahrefs, Semrush, or Screaming Frog, settle on whether the firm uses its very own seat or you license seats and grant access.

Content IP must be unambiguous. You must possess all drafts, last material, photos, and acquired works upon repayment. If the firm utilizes service providers, the contract must include a service warranty that all specialists designate IP to the firm and afterwards to you. Ask to see the service provider agreement language. If they stop, move on.

If the regional SEO strategy consists of citations, directories, or map listings, ensure they are developed under your company emails, not the agency's. That way, if you component methods, the properties stay undamaged. This is specifically important with collector services that can be tough to altercation after the fact.

Link purchase that endures a manual review

Link structure remains a delicate subject. Google's support changes in tone, yet the useful fact holds: quality defeats quantity, and footprint matters. Write link terms that shield you.

Ban paid link schemes, personal blog site networks, and automated outreach at range. Need that any kind of funded placements be classified, nofollowed where ideal, and revealed. Establish quality limits such as domain requirements, yet do not decrease it to a single statistics like Domain Authority. Consist of topical relevance, web traffic quotes, and content standards.

Ask the firm to offer month-to-month link logs with resource Links, outreach context, support message, and whether the link was earned, sponsored, or component of a partnership. Book the right to veto websites prior to positioning if needed. For Boston companies, regional relevance often defeats global vanity metrics. A link from a respected Boston community publication can move the needle more than an arbitrary high‑DA blog.

Include a removal provision. If a future algorithm update decreases the value of a pattern of web links acquired during the interaction, the firm should support cleanup, outreach for modifications, or disavow evaluation within a practical number of hours at no extra price. You are not seeking an assurance versus algorithms, only a dedication to assist fix what they influence.

Technical SEO is a joint sport: compose it that way

Technical SEO stops working when it becomes a record that no one executes. Effective involvements treat it like a shared engineering project.

The agreement must call for technical findings to be supplied as workable tickets in your task system with issue priority, approximated influence, approval criteria, and test steps. Settle on the prioritization rubric. For example, fixes that open crawl efficiency for thousands of web pages or remove index bloat take priority over micro‑optimizations. If you work in sprints, the company must participate in sprint preparation with your dev team, not throw a PDF over the wall.

If you intend a redesign or migration during the term, create a migration appendix up front. Include responsibilities for URL mapping, staging reviews, redirect strategies, pre‑launch QA, and post‑launch tracking. A number of the most awful traffic drops in Boston I have actually seen originated from movements where SEO signed up with the celebration far too late. Put the trigger problems in the contract to make sure that SEO is informed at the start of any type of task that touches design templates, navigation, or website architecture.

Agree on web page speed targets by template family members, not an abstract score. A sensible goal may be Largest Contentful Paint under 2.5 seconds on mobile for key landing themes measured by field data. This sets a bar without securing you right into chasing lab ratings that do not reflect reality.
